PREBLE COUNTY — UPDATE @ 1:56 a.m.:
The left lane has reopened on I-70 in Preble County, according to an OSHP dispatcher.
Troopers remain on scene. No injuries were reported at this time.
INITIAL REPORT:
State troopers responded to a semi fire on Interstate 70 late Saturday night.

State troopers from the Dayton Post of the Ohio State Highway Patrol (OSHP) were dispatched around 11:24 p.m. to the I-70 EB near State Route 503 on a reported semi fire, according to an OSHP dispatcher.
All lanes are closed on I-70 EB approaching State Route 503 exit in Preble County.
